Notification center on future Android versions

Notification center in Android can be so much better if we could divide apps into groups like news, messaging, social, games etc and each group having a separate tab on notification screen. That way we can first create a news group and then separate News notifications from youtube notifications from facebook notifications from WhatsApp notifications.
